
Registered
- Cornelis Lenstra, born on May 27, 1830 in Steenwijk, turfmaker by profession
- Aaltje Bijkerk, born on August 28, 1847 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Lummigje Lenstra, born on December 17, 1875 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Aaltje Lenstra, born on September 3, 1879 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Grietje Lenstra, born on January 14, 1882 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Johannes Lemstra, born on September 19, 1878 in Steenwijkerwold, turfmaker by profession
- Trijntje de Jonge, born on November 3, 1884 in Oldemarkt, no profession
- Roelof Lemstra, born on September 27, 1903 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Trijntje Lemstra, born on July 8, 1905 in Oldemarkt, no profession
- Hiltje Lemstra, born on July 17, 1907 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Roelof Reitze Lemstra, born on August 29, 1909 in Steenwijkerwold, no profession
- Reitze Lemstra, born on August 29, 1911 in Steenwijkerwold
Source citation
Municipality Steenwijkerland, Population register
Bevolkingsregister 1890-1920 L, Steenwijk, archive 2, inventory number 42, folio 1488
